In this article, i explain how you can increase your blog subscribers using the “What would Seth Godin Do” Wordpress Plugin…
What is the “What would Seth Godin Do” Wordpress Plugin?
This wordpress plugin helps you increase your RSS subscribers by simply asking your readers to subscribe to your RSS feed before the start of your every post.
Why are RSS subscribers so important?
RSS Subscribers are people who read your blog regularly and wish to use RSS feed readers to be informed of any new posts on your blog regularly.
This means that these readers find your blog interesting and of value to them, so they want to keep track of your blog posts.
Generally, the more readers you have subscribed to your RSS, the larger your chances of converting this readership pool to money!
The more readers you have = the higher your blog traffic = higher chances of selling affiliate products OR earning advertising revenue from displaying ads like Google Adsense or Bidvertiser on your blog.
How does the “What would Seth Godin Do” Wordpress Plugin work?
By default, new visitors to your blog will see a small box above each post containing the words “If you’re new here, you may want to subscribe to my RSS feed. Thanks for visiting!” After 5 visits the message disappears. You can customize this message, its lifespan, and its location. The message can be excluded from Pages if desired.
You can also specify a message for return visitors.
This plugin requires cookies. Users without support for cookies will always see the new visitor message.
New visitors will appreciate some context and background information about your site. This is your chance to offer them a special welcome and invite them to become permanent subscribers.
How do you install it?
1. Download the plugin here.
2. Use an FTP (File Transfer Protocol) program like CoreFTP to upload it to your blog’s “wp-content/plugins” folder.
3. Then activate it in your Wordpress admin dashboard under “Plugins”
